深入剖析百度智能搜索系统中的相似性分析算法
1.0 简介
在数字时代,随着图像技术的飞速发展,我们面临着越来越多的图片信息。如何高效地找到与特定图片相似的内容成为了一个挑战。百度识图作为一款强大的AI工具,为用户提供了一个解决方案。
2.0 百度识图的基本原理
百度识图基于先进的人工智能技术,可以快速准确地对待处理的图片进行分类和标注。这包括但不限于物体检测、场景理解、人脸识别等功能。在这些功能中,相似性分析是核心部分,它能够帮助我们找出与某个图片最为接近或类似的其他图片。
3.0 相似性分析算法概述
在寻找相同或类似的图片时,我们需要借助一些复杂的计算机视觉和机器学习算法。常见的有卷积神经网络(CNN)、支持向量机(SVM)等。这些算法可以根据输入数据训练模型,并通过比较两幅照片中特征点的一致性来判断它们之间是否存在关系。
4.0 CNN在相似性分析中的应用
CNN是一种非常有效的人工神经网络,它特别擅长处理空间数据结构,如图像和视频。在百度识图中,使用CNN可以实现自动化地提取和比较不同尺寸、位置上的特征,这对于大规模数据库内精确匹配至关重要。
5.0 SVM在相似性分析中的角色
虽然CNN现在是主流,但SVM依然是一个强大的工具尤其是在简单到中级的问题上表现优异。当我们需要更快捷简洁地处理大量数据时,SVM提供了一种稳健且可靠的手段。此外,由于它不需要大量训练样本,所以适合小型数据库环境下的应用。
6.0 实际案例研究:找相似画像与百度AI引擎结合
假设你有一张古老家庭照片,你希望找到这张照片里人物可能所处年代内其他人的画像。这将是一个典型的情境,在这个情境下,你可以利用百度AI平台上的相关服务,将你的目标照片上传并设置条件,比如时间范围、地点或者服饰类型,然后让系统去检索符合条件的所有可能结果。如果幸运的话,你很可能会发现一系列具有惊人相似的历史肖像画,从而揭开过去未知故事的一角。
7.0 未来的展望:科技革新带来的进步
随着技术不断进步,无论是硬件还是软件层面的改进,都将使得我们的生活更加便捷。未来我们预计能看到更高效率、高准确性的搜索引擎,不仅仅局限于文本信息,还能瞬间检索到任何形式及数量级别的大量媒体资源。而这样的能力将极大地方便人们获取知识和享受娱乐,同时也促使更多创意作品产生,从而推动社会文化发展前行。